Xbox Experience preview now available

If you signed up for the preview of the new Xbox Experience, it's live and includes Netflix streaming.

Although the long awaited and anticipated Xbox Live Experience update for the Xbox 360 doesn't officially launch until tomorrow, the update is now available if you happened to be one of the well-foresighted gamers who signed up for a preview using a valid console ID.

Additionally the anticipated arrival of Netflix streaming to the Xbox comes with the update. Streaming is free for Netflix subscribers who also subscribe to Xbox Live Gold.
